Capacity and Size Options
Choosing the right capacity and size for your race fuel belt flask system is essential to stay properly hydrated without sacrificing comfort. I recommend considering the total capacity you’ll need, which usually ranges from 110 ml (3.5 oz) to 280 ml (10 oz). Larger bottles hold more fluid but can add weight and bulk, potentially affecting mobility. It’s also important to evaluate individual bottle sizes to ensure they fit comfortably in your pockets or belt. Flexibility is key, so look for systems offering various capacity options, allowing you to customize based on your race length and intensity. Ultimately, balancing hydration needs with ease of access and comfort will help you select a system that supports your endurance without hindering your performance.
Material and Safety Features
Selecting a race fuel belt flask system that prioritizes material safety is essential for your health and performance. I look for systems made from BPA-free or food-grade materials to prevent harmful chemicals from leaching into my hydration or nutrition. Durability is key, so I choose impact-resistant options like stainless steel or high-quality BPA-free plastics that can withstand active use and accidental drops. Leak-proof caps and secure sealing mechanisms are a must to avoid spills during vigorous movement. Additionally, I prefer systems that are dishwasher safe or easy to clean, ensuring hygiene over time. Finally, verifying compliance with safety standards and avoiding harmful substances such as PVC, phthalates, or lead gives me peace of mind, knowing my system is safe and reliable for long-distance events.
Ease of Refilling
A race fuel belt flask system that’s easy to replenish can make a big difference during long runs or rides. Look for models with wide-mouth openings, which allow quick, spill-free filling with liquids or gels. Refillable bottles with secure screw-on caps or leak-proof closures help prevent messes and make refilling hassle-free, even during short breaks. Systems with removable or attachable bottles enable you to refill without removing the entire belt, saving time and effort. Materials that are dishwasher safe make cleaning simple, ensuring hygiene without extra hassle. Additionally, choosing refillable reservoirs compatible with various liquids or gels streamlines the process, reducing the need for multiple containers. Prioritizing ease of refilling ensures you stay fueled with minimal interruption.
Fit and Adjustability
Ensuring your race fuel belt fits snugly and stays secure throughout your activity is essential for comfort and performance. Look for systems with adjustable straps or belts that can accommodate waist sizes from 24 to 45 inches, providing a customizable fit. Quick-release buckles or Velcro closures make it easy to adjust on the fly without losing stability. Multiple adjustment points help tailor the fit, preventing bouncing or chafing during high-impact movement. Materials like neoprene or elastic components add stretchability, allowing the belt to adapt comfortably to different body shapes and sizes. A well-fitting belt remains secure even when carrying varying amounts of fuel or hydration, ensuring you stay comfortable and focused during your race or workout.

How Do I Clean and Maintain My Race Belt Flasks?
To keep my race belt flasks clean, I rinse them thoroughly with warm water after each use and occasionally use a mild soap. I make sure to scrub the inside gently with a bottle brush and rinse well to remove any residue. Letting them air dry completely prevents mold. Regular maintenance like this keeps my flasks fresh, odor-free, and ready for my next ultra-endurance event.
